Job Description

Director Of Finance

Represents Jefferson Health Finance in a clinical region assignment working under the direction of Regional CFO. Supports planning, performance review, and initiative execution of assigned operating areas and programs. Heavily collaborates with operations leaders and coordinates service delivery across enterprise finance functions. Comfortable leading through influence in a matrix management model. Some on-site presence required with remote work balance at the determination of Regional CFO.

Essential Functions

  • Interacts with co-workers, visitors, and other staff consistent with the values of Jefferson.
  • Facilitates the annual operating budgeting for assigned operating areas; assists in the identification of performance improvement opportunities and develops the appropriate measurement and tracking to desired outcomes.
  • Supports performance analyses (e.g. budget variances and trends, labor, supplies, and volume performance drill-down etc.) and financial forecasts.
  • Supports capital and strategic business plan development as assigned.
  • Supports development of financial presentations and other key deliverables to the Regional CFO and other operations leaders.
  • Advises operations leaders on financial matters and represents finance team in operations meetings as directed by Regional CFO.
  • Serves as a liaison between operations and other Corporate Finance functions (e.g. financial accounting and reporting, enterprise budget and capital management, revenue cycle, supply chain, decision support, etc.) as well as other corporate services functions.

Minimum Education and Experience Requirements:

Education:

  • BS in Business Administration, Health Care Administration, Finance or a related Field required.
  • Master’s degree preferred.

Experience:

  • 7 plus years of progressively responsible finance experience within a hospital system, health care setting or corporate office for a large organization.
  • Experience in a large academic healthcare setting is desirable.
  • Advanced use of Microsoft Word, Excel, PowerPoint

  • Experienced user of standard financial systems/tools in healthcare setting (i.e. Workday/Lawson/Cerner, budgeting system, business intelligence dashboards, etc.)

Nationally ranked, Jefferson, which is principally located in the greater Philadelphia region, Lehigh Valley and Northeastern Pennsylvania and southern New Jersey, is reimagining health care and higher education to create unparalleled value. Jefferson is more than 65,000 people strong, dedicated to providing the highest-quality, compassionate clinical care for patients; making our communities healthier and stronger; preparing tomorrow's professional leaders for 21st-century careers; and creating new knowledge through basic/programmatic, clinical and applied research. Thomas Jefferson University, home of Sidney Kimmel Medical College, Jefferson College of Nursing, and the Kanbar College of Design, Engineering and Commerce, dates back to 1824 and today comprises 10 colleges and three schools offering 200+ undergraduate and graduate programs to more than 8,300 students. Jefferson Health, nationally ranked as one of the top 15 not-for-profit health care systems in the country and the largest provider in the Philadelphia and Lehigh Valley areas, serves patients through millions of encounters each year at 32 hospitals campuses and more than 700 outpatient and urgent care locations throughout the region. Jefferson Health Plans is a not-for-profit managed health care organization providing a broad range of health coverage options in Pennsylvania and New Jersey for more than 35 years.
